‘I’ll leave immediately’ – Klopp warns Germany after appointment

July 24, 2026
in Sports
Reading Time: 2 mins read

New Germany head coach, Jurgen Klopp has delivered a stern warning to the German Football Association, DFB, during his introduction as the new manager. 

The former Liverpool manager is embarking on his first venture in international football, following a highly successful tenure at the club level.

At his unveiling, Klopp spoke to the media and the public, emphasising that he has no interest in the position if it comes with significant criticism. He also clarified that he does not intend to pursue any other role after his time with the national team.

He stated, “The day you no longer want me, I will leave – without any severance pay. If you declare tomorrow that I am inadequate, I will depart. It cannot be just one individual; it must be a collective sentiment. 

“If the DFB decides I am not suitable, I will go. If you act poorly and do not allow my family to have peace, I will leave. Feel free to criticize me if things do not go well. I am willing to address it. 

“The focus is on the job. Jürgen Klopp does not have a career beyond the national team. Ideally, this will be the pinnacle of my career,” he stated.

Jurgen Klopp has been convinced to take on the role of head coach for Die Mannschaft, succeeding Julian Nagelsmann after the team was unexpectedly eliminated by Paraguay, failing to progress to the Round of 16 for the third consecutive tournament.

Klopp had been without a coaching position since 2024, having departed Liverpool at the conclusion of the 2023-24 season. During his time at Anfield, he secured nearly every title and played a pivotal role in revitalizing the club over nine years, and the DFB is hopeful that he can achieve similar success with Germany.
